- Denne varer er brugt Beskrivelse Burnout 5 gives players license to wreak havoc in Paradise City, the ultimate seamless racing battleground, with a massive infrastructure of traffic-heavy roads to abuse. Gone is the need to jump in and out of menus and aimlessly search for fun like many open world games; in Burnout 5, every inch of the world is built to deliver heart-stopping Burnout-style gameplay. Every intersection is a potential crash junction and every alleyway is an opportunity to rack up moving violations.Of course, rules are made to be broken, and when gamers enter Paradise City, they're assigned a Drivers License that quickly begins to amass a record of player's most aggressive, reckless and destructive exploits behind the wheel. But it's not the law that's eyeing player's progress … when gamers push things too hard they'll be squaring off against the city's most infamous burners, and these legends aren't interested in who crosses the finish line first. Burnout: Paradise is all about having a seamless, open-world gameplay experience. The entire world is unlocked from the start. There are 34 AI drivers in the world all present from the start of the game. The player starts each game session in free-burn, with no set path through the game. Sony's Japan Studio shipped it in 1999 as the first PlayStation game to require both analog sticks – left stick steers Spike, right stick swings the Stun Club and the Time Net – and the original digital pad got politely told to sit down. That gamble is what makes it the defining late-era PS1 game to collect: a first-party title that only makes sense on Sony's own hardware, released in the console's victory-lap years. Same disc, same manual, same everything – except one spine is black and the other wears a red stripe. To a casual buyer they're interchangeable. To a collector, only one of them is the copy. The Dreamcast landed in North America with a launch lineup that actually mattered, a 128-bit Hitachi SH-4 CPU, and a built-in 56k modem nobody else was brave enough to bundle. It was the first console of the sixth generation, and it beat the PlayStation 2 to market by more than a year. And then it was gone.
